Dan Gladden Bio

Dan Gladden is a former professional baseball player hailing from the United States. Born on July 7, 1957, in San Jose, California, Gladden grew up with a passion for the sport that would eventually shape his career. Known for his exceptional speed and dependable fielding skills, Gladden primarily played as an outfielder during his time in the Major Leagues. He spent a majority of his career with the Minnesota Twins and played a crucial role in their World Series championship runs in 1987 and 1991.

Gladden's journey into professional baseball began when he was drafted by the San Francisco Giants in the ninth round of the 1979 Major League Baseball draft. He spent a few years honing his skills in the minor leagues before making his debut in the Major Leagues in 1983. Throughout his career, Gladden was recognized for his fierce competitiveness, incredible work ethic, and unwavering determination on and off the field.

Though Gladden spent time with the San Francisco Giants, Detroit Tigers, and Minnesota Twins during his career, he is often most associated with the latter team. In 1987, Gladden's impact on the Twins was particularly significant. As the leadoff hitter and left fielder, he played a pivotal role in helping the team secure their first World Series title since relocating to Minnesota. Gladden's memorable performance in Game 7 of the World Series, where he scored the go-ahead run, is often cited as one of his career highlights.

After retiring from a successful baseball career, Gladden transitioned into broadcasting and became a regular voice on the radio for the Minnesota Twins. His deep knowledge and love for the sport made him a valuable commentator, providing insights into the game he had mastered as a player.
